Get ready for our next episode of The Piano Pod: The Embodied Pianist with Elena Riu — pianist, groundbreaking recording artist, educator, and yoga/mindfulness teacher.
In this powerful conversation, we explore embodied performance, somatics, breath, creativity, cultural identity, and even the menstrual cycle as a source of artistic insight. Elena’s work challenges long-held assumptions about what pianists should play, how they should train, and how the body shapes sound.
In this episode, Elena and I talk about:
- ✅ Her journey from Venezuela to the UK — and how navigating multiple identities shaped her artistry
- ✅ The creation of Salsa Nueva and the importance of commissioning new works
